The open source version tduck-v2 was updated on June 23, 2021. It's been 200 days since the last time I sat in front of the computer with the holy code word

Codeword is always excited and distressed at this time. The reason for excitement is that there will be a new version to meet you again, and the reason for distress is: good pain, no creative inspiration!
Back to the point, let’s first review what we did in 200 days.


[Pro private server work order, submitting work order can facilitate problem precipitation]

[new official website of tduckcloud made in October]

[the small poster of this updated official publicity is from designers who have not studied design]
This time, tduckpro v2 0 update functions are as follows:
1. Add a process form, < U style = “box sizing: inherit;” >Implementation of workflow based on activiti7< / u >, when creating a new form, you can select a process form to create a process form, which supports process approval of data submitted by logged in users and non logged in users.

2. Process design supports approvers and condition nodes. Approvers can be set to positions, roles, personnel, etc. (multiple choices are supported). They can pass or reject the process, send requests to the specified API, set field permissions that can be viewed or edited in the approval node, and dynamically select the next branch according to the form submission data.

3. Add < U style = “box sizing: inherit;” >Approval related pages< / u >, including my process, pending my approval, completed tasks and other pages, supporting pass, reject, return tasks, etc. Support to view submitted form data, flow chart and flow steps.

4. Add < U style = “box sizing: inherit;” >Message module</u>, including my message (system announcement notice, etc.), message log, message template, etc. (system mail, SMS template ID, official account template message ID can be configured).

5. Add system configuration function to support page configuration < U style = “box sizing: inherit;” >System basic information</u>logo, name, email, official account, SMS channel, file storage, OCR and other configurations.

6. Add numbers, sliders, sorting, employee selection, Department selection, OCR identification, etc. to the form component.

7. Add < U style = “box sizing: inherit;” > to form settingsSave the uncommitted data switch and fill in the password< / u > switch.

8. Add folder function to form and manage form files in groups.

9. Overall optimization of system UI and increase internationalization I18N support.

10. The front page panel is redesigned to add process, station information and other sections, common functions, etc.

11. The form query function is added to support the selection of submitters.

12. Optimize the loading speed of form page submission page (continue to optimize).
For more details, you can experience the operation in the online demonstration version:https://pro.tduckapp.com
If you think the project is helpful to you, please don’t hesitate to give us a star, which is our greatest support. Project address:https://gitee.com/TDuckApp
By tduck technical team * * * * January 15, 2022